My second baby is due in October. My first was born spring 2014 and determined not to spend a fortune on a travel system, I went for a britax b-agile. This was great when she was tiny, easy and compact and quick to clip the car seat to when nipping into shops etc and we used the Pram part for walks/days out.

It was however, rubbish when she got bigger and hard to push. I had a petite star/njoy bubble, an umbrella fold stroller that faced both ways. I LOVED it. They aren’t made anymore :(

I thought I’d got for a cosatto to and fro for any second child but they only like flat parent facing, so that’s out as no1 stayed parent facing in the bubble for ages, until it died. Then I had a Joie Nitro which was brill and lasted her till she was done.

So now I’m tempted to go for a slightly more expensive travel system/pushchair that can parent face for longer. Or is there another parent facing umbrella fold stroller in the world?

I had hoped, 5 years on someone would have invented something!
